I often have the same problem with my GPS device. A lot of recorded tracks have
2 or 3 erroneous height data at the
beginning. The bad track points are easy to identify because the difference in
height is significant.
I use my standard text editor (jedit) to remove the respective points (text between and inclusive
the "<trkpt" and "
</trkpt> key words).
May be it is not a recommendable method for all editors but for me its very
fast and works without modifying the rest.

I have a gpx track, and the first 2 points are 10 km from the next point
so I'd like to delete them, but when I do, I lose the time data for the
rest of the gpx track? Why? Is there a way to do this? I'm using
'edit track points', 'delete a point'.
